Left the dock at about 645 and threw live shrimp and gulp around the broken islands in 4 horse. 10-15 east wind and a falling tide. 8 keeper trout, a sheepshead , a bunch of rat reds , and a 40 inch bull red. Bull red broke my net.
Waiting on the weather to cool down.
